Chinese film ?Tuya?s Marriage? wins in Berlin
Tue, 20 Feb 2007 20:11:49 +0000 | China View
By Erik Kirschbaum and Mike Collett-White, Reuters, Feb 17, 2007- BERLIN (Reuters) - Chinese movie “Tuya’s Marriage”, which explores the environmental and human cost of the country’s rapid economic growth through the lives of Mongolian herders, won the Berlin film festival’s top honor on Saturday.
